Ticket: Missed pick-up — Bracken & Holt consignment

The scheduled collection by Veylan Couriers did not occur on Tuesday as arranged; no driver arrived and no notice was given. We have cancelled the booking and reassigned the job to Orrister Freight, with collection rescheduled for Thursday morning. Please ensure the replacement driver is given the confidential hand-over instruction noted directly below.

drop instructions, yafog-yawip: the quenmir olidor courier leaves the julox tamion keliel ledger at gate 5283 under passcode 336825

// Client setup for the Sproutline watering scheduler.
// Release manager: this block must ship with every cut.
// The client talks to the Drizzleplan forecast service to
// shift watering windows around rain. Timeouts are 5s; do
// not raise them, the scheduler retries on its own. Staging
// and prod use separate keys — never reuse across envs.
// Rotate at release time, not after. Current staging key
// for Drizzleplan follows.

API key for yahig-tadup: kto7_ubizbYm

Step 4: Update the ShrinkCart CLI to the 3.x pipeline. The old `resize-batch` subcommand is replaced by `pipeline run`, and per-directory overrides now live in a single manifest instead of scattered dotfiles. Delete any leftover `.shrinkrc` files before proceeding, as they take precedence and will silently skip the new manifest. Once the binary is upgraded, confirm the runtime picks up these settings:

service settings:
PRAIX_LOG_LEVEL=error
PRAIX_METRICS_HOST=metrics.praix.qorvelcorp.corp
PRAIX_POOL_SIZE=16

// TILECACHE_EVICTION_BATCH
// Number of rendered tiles the Quarrow cache layer evicts per sweep.
// Raising this reduces memory pressure on the Larkfield render nodes
// but increases cold-tile latency after zoom changes. The value was
// tuned during the 4.2 hardening pass and should not change without a
// full cache-hit regression run. Release manager: verify the deployed
// binary matches the tuning run before sign-off. The trace token from
// that run is recorded directly below.

pipeline stamp: htk9_ce63042d9